.Synopsis For High Island to the Matagorda Ship Channel Out 60 NM
including Galveston and Matagorda Bays.

Light to occasionally moderate east to southeast winds today will become
southeast tonight and Monday, and this southeast flow will then persist
and gradually strengthen for the remainder of the week. Caution flags
might be needed for the increasing winds and building seas.
